## Nightrun Scheduler: limits and quotas

Nightrun dispatches backfill jobs between 01:00 and 05:00 shard-local time. Per-tenant concurrency is capped; excess jobs queue to the next window. Jobs exceeding the runtime ceiling are killed and retried once with half parallelism.

Reviewers: any change touching dispatch must respect these caps — they're load-bearing for the Coldmere warehouse tier, not suggestions. Quota overrides require a capacity sign-off.

Enforced limits are defined as constants in the dispatcher:

tuning table, yajog-yahof:
BUDGETS = {
    "lamvan": 303,
    "wenox": 460,
    "fenvan": 525,
}

## Recovery — Planner Regression Rollback (Ostlery DB)

If the v4.2 planner regression forces a rollback and the migration account is locked, releases halt. Unlock via the Ostlery admin shell: disable plan caching, restore the v4.1 planner snapshot, then re-enable the account. The shell prompts for the migration account's recovery passphrase, provided below.

unlock words, yawig-kagef: gordor-holvan-ulaael-pramir-ulaiel-tamdor

## Shard Migration — Plugin Compat

Profile store splits into 16 shards. Plugins must route reads via the Hollowgate proxy; direct store access breaks after cutover. Use shard-aware batch calls only. Writes during migration are dual-committed; expect up to 2s lag. Test against the Hollowgate staging endpoint before publishing. Staging auth uses the internal key below.

API key for tagag-yahog: vxb3-wni

Subject: Handover — Ferngate fuel report. Taking over Ferngate fleet fuel-usage reporting from this week. Monthly run is already scheduled; exports land in the Copperline share by the 3rd. Validation script flags any depot over 8% variance. Only open item: re-sign the export job after the rotation. The current deploy key you'll need is below.

deploy key for yajeg-hahog: bky3_BZq